Mr. Richard E. Adams, 96, of the Lone Oak Community of Meriwether County and formerly of Munster, Indiana, passed away Saturday, July 2, 2016, at Hospice LaGrange.
Mr. Adams was born May 3, 1920, in Whiting , Indiana, son of the late Merrill Blanchard Adams and Lillian Eberle Adams. A veteran of service in the U.S. Navy during World War Two, he was a member of the American Legion for 61 years and a member of Post 186 in Greenville at the time of his death. He was a retired millwright and carpenter and was a member of Millwright and Erectors Union Local 1076 in Indiana for 76 years. A resident of Lone Oak since 1985, Mr. Adams was a member of Allen-Lee Memorial United Methodist Church.
Survivors include his wife of 66 years, Claire Adams of Lone Oak; sons, David R. Adams of Indiana, Thomas R. Adams and his wife Katherine of Lone Oak, Craig S. Adams of Lone Oak, Jeffrey M. Adams of Calumet City, IL; granddaughter, Amanda Adams of Florida; and step-grandchildren, Robert Whitlock of Newnan, Rachel Whitlock of Lone Oak.
